1.0 INTRODUCTION

Over the recent decades many parts of the world have experienced high frequency of extreme weather events such as floods and droughts which have been linked to climate change.The main indicator of climate change has been the rise in global temperature which has principally been linked with increase of carbon dioxide in the atmosphere. Instrumental records indicate an increase of ≈0.3-0.6°C in global mean surface temperature over the last 100 years (IPCC, 1992; 1995; 2001).

2.0 DATA AND METHODOLOGY

Mean monthly data for CO2 for Mahe(Seychelles) carbon dioxide baseline station, NDVI from DMC Harare, rainfall from TMA were used in this study The data was subjected to standard statistical methods of time series analysis, which included trend and spectral analysis on monthly, seasonal and annual time scale.

MONTHLY NDVI CONT’

From figure 3 the NDVI shows high values in May / December when the land has maximum foliage cover after the long / short rains in areas with bimodal rainfall distribution ( Musoma, Bukoba, Arusha, Tanga and Dar es Salaam).

In areas with unimodal rainfall distribution the high values in NDVI are observed in March/April (Kigoma, Tabora, Dodoma, Morogoro,Songea) the period of maximum foliage cover.

Seasonal analysis of NDVI in the country shows that the vegetation index decreases and increase in some seasons. A significant decrease has been noted in Tabora SON with R2≈0.6446, figure 4. Arusha and Dodoma has negative trend in all seasons, table 1. This signifies a decrease of rainfall or deforestation. Grazing is dominant in these regions. With a reduction of vegetation the consumption of CO2 is reduced, hence accumulation in the atmosphere.

Rainfall time series shows that rainfall is increasing in some parts of the country while the NDVI is decreasing (Shinyanga, Morogoro, Mbeya, Tabora) may be due to:deforestation going on in the area.Over grazingForest fire & deliberate fire for clearing farmsOnly Songea has positive trend in NDVI and rainfall in MAM and JJA. Tanga and Kigoma has a decrease in rainfall but an increase in NDVI in DJF, MAM and JJA table 1 and 2.

3.0 Monthly concentration of CO2

bimodal distribution is evident with minimum in January and May the time when we have high values in NDVI. This pattern may be associated with seasonal variation in the vegetation cover through (photosynthesis).

SEASONAL TREND OF CO2 CONT’

Figure 3 shows thatOn seasonal basis :

(SON) has the largest trend ≈ (1.48) MAM has the lowest trend ≈ (1.42)

This can be related with the vegetation cover, SON the land is bare, forest fire and most of the people prepare their farms by burning. While in MAM the land has maximum foliage cover.

CONCLUSION

This study shows that:An increase of CO2 will cause increased land degradation due to increase in frequency and intensity of severe weather and extreme climatic events (floods & droughts)Increased land degradation will lead to:

-Reduced retention of soil moisture-Increased soil erosion
